What would Paddington say! Charity shop is slammed by customers for selling empty marmalade jars for more than the cost of a full one

A charity shop has left customers fuming after it was caught selling empty marmalade jars for more than the price of a full one.

The Bonne Maman second-hand item, priced at £2.50, was spotted by eagle-eyed shopper Laura McInerney, 41, in a British Heart Foundation store in Newham, London.

In comparison, an unopened jar of the fruit preserve currently retails for £2.20 from Ocado, discounted from £3.50.

High street supermarkets such as Sainsbury's and Tesco sell theirs at a slightly higher price, at £3.30, but they also contain the actual marmalade.
